Ran Wei

Head of Strategic Finance at Atomic

Ran Wei is the current head of strategic finance at Atomic. Ran has over ten years of experience in the finance and technology industries.

Ran began their career as an investment banking associate at Citi in 2011. Ran then moved to Susquehanna Growth Equity (SGE) as a growth equity intern in 2009. In this role, Ran developed a Java software package for a back-end service that calculated risk exposures of equity indices.

In 2015, Ran joined Qatalyst Partners as a vice president. During their time at Qatalyst, Ran worked on various acquisitions and sales, including the $1.1Bn sale of Quantenna to ON Semiconductor and the $48.4Bn sale of NXP to Qualcomm (terminated).

Ran joined Atomic in 2019 and is currently the head of strategic finance.

Ran Wei completed a Bachelor of Science in Computer Science at the University of Pennsylvania, followed by a Bachelor of Science in Finance at The Wharton School. Ran then attended high school at University of Toronto Schools.

Ran Wei reports to Jack Abraham, Managing Partner and CEO. They are on a team with Sharon Winter - Vice President, Danny Evens - Head of Capital Markets, and Hadley Wilkins - VP of Communications. and Jake Becker - Strategic Finance reports to Ran Wei.
